Police executed a search warrant of residential premises and discovered more than eight pounds of marijuana in a detached garage and a loaded pistol in the house. On these stipulated facts, the district court found appellant guilty of fifth-degree possession of a controlled substance (possession with intent to sell) and sentenced him under the firearm-enhancement statute.
